Commit graph

29 commits

Author SHA1 Message Date
b157a87647 factor out modules; modal -> dialog 2025-04-06 16:05:48 +03:00
2e072cb51c allow exiting from modals; add buttons 2025-04-04 16:32:56 +03:00
48f651fc0f factor input handling into modes 2025-04-03 23:29:35 +03:00
59c2fdcbcd emit tasks for columns 2025-03-27 19:50:38 +02:00
859da8e5d1 pass whole state to setter, to emit tasks 2025-03-24 04:54:35 +02:00
d26c46d6e1 remove redundant generic 2025-03-24 03:57:43 +02:00
870bf249d8 add edit modes 2025-03-24 03:37:36 +02:00
b2ed389edd start defining update tasks 2025-03-24 00:14:31 +02:00
a38d103d7d non-abbreviated function names 2025-03-24 00:14:13 +02:00
41b6a0cd57 add value bar 2025-03-23 23:10:04 +02:00
cf18e32e13 refactor; EntryInfo -> Metadata 2025-03-23 19:00:45 +02:00
95aa9f8b02 set multiple values in table 2025-03-23 18:40:27 +02:00
29435bb937 add SIZE column and paths_under 2025-03-23 18:14:09 +02:00
1a00ef1ff6 allow for multisetters 2025-03-23 17:23:10 +02:00
13600a5837 add placeholders for editing whole directories 2025-03-23 00:20:57 +02:00
f9885713cc implement setters 2025-03-22 22:04:11 +02:00
7c4451e46f only enter edit mode for columns with setters 2025-03-22 21:50:16 +02:00
138bba99cb add optional column setters 2025-03-22 21:01:33 +02:00
c3fbc6abf1 edit the correct column 2025-03-22 20:50:55 +02:00
ac8e3dd198 refactor table render; fix backspace; only works in col 0? 2025-03-22 01:53:00 +02:00
bc067e2739 load metadata using lofty (shout out @Frieder_Hannenheim - you are #1) 2025-03-16 08:50:29 +02:00
a0f1577744 multithreaded scan 2025-03-11 15:24:15 +02:00
928d38bfaa identify files manually by magic numbers 2025-03-11 14:59:11 +02:00
5d7c2054b3 collect unknowns too 2025-03-10 12:15:27 +02:00
5336ee358a wip: basic editing 2025-03-09 05:15:15 +02:00
2903d58b2d fix all warns, remove moku, bind edit keys 2025-03-09 05:01:14 +02:00
41c5686d67 open files with space 2025-03-09 04:47:44 +02:00
8cc9418272 dynamic columns; macro keydefs 2025-03-09 04:38:28 +02:00
b29511c23e read id3 tags 2025-03-08 00:24:36 +02:00